Output d63b7a27b297690ed9f46a93b6f6bd3d4c0efe504d34a54089cb6b21b5a37166:7

value
4676511
script pubkey
OP_0 OP_PUSHBYTES_20 be8e306b6ea40874185ce65986dbddd52fbeb0cc
address
bc1qh68rq6mw5sy8gxzuuevcdk7a65hmavxvwuxyh2
transaction
d63b7a27b297690ed9f46a93b6f6bd3d4c0efe504d34a54089cb6b21b5a37166
spent
true